Pipe snaking services involve using specialized tools to clear blockages and obstructions within a property's plumbing system. This process typically involves inserting a long, flexible auger or snake into the drain or pipe to break up and remove debris such as hair, grease, soap scum, or accumulated buildup. The goal is to restore proper flow and prevent backups that can cause inconvenience or damage. Pipe snaking is a practical solution for resolving stubborn clogs deep within the plumbing lines that cannot be cleared with basic plunging or chemical treatments.
These services are often sought when drains are slow to empty, or when foul odors and gurgling sounds indicate a blockage. Persistent clogs in kitchen sinks, bathroom drains, or main sewer lines are common reasons to consider pipe snaking. It can also help address problems caused by tree roots infiltrating underground pipes, or when debris has accumulated over time, impairing the system’s function. The overview below groups typical Pipe Snaking proj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ine pipe snaking jobs like clearing minor clogs usually range from $150 to $350. Many common issues fall within this range, making it a cost-effective solution for basic blockages.
Moderate Blockages - More involved snaking services for larger or more stubborn obstructions tend to cost between $350 and $600. These projects are common and represent the middle tier of typical service costs.
Extensive or Difficult Jobs - Larger, more complex pipe cleaning projects can range from $600 to $1,200, especially if additional work is required. Fewer projects push into this higher range, but it covers more challenging situations.
Full Pipe Replacement - When snaking is part of a pipe replacement process, costs can exceed $2,000 and may go up to $5,000+ for extensive or difficult replacements. These are less common and usually involve significant plumbing work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
